The current trunk code has accumulated enough fixes to be
routinely released as 0.14.8 in the end of December:
bugfix: adjusted hardcoded values in VLAN trigger
bugfix: adjusted HW, SW and port types in SNMP data collector
bugfix: Cisco connector: tolerate switch ports in suspended state
bugfix: nameless object in link list could not be clicked
bugfix: fix SQL tables structure
bugfix: Live VLANs displayed VLANs missing from switch table improperly
bugfix: sort auth data by username
update: corrected some dictionary entries
update: better layout for Live VLANs tab
new feature: UI option to control asset tag warning
new feature: UUID (RFC4122) sticker
new feature: empty rackspace detector
new feature: initial wiki-style markup support in dictionary
